How can a company ensure that its customer-centric initiatives are not only improving customer satisfaction, but also driving long-term customer loyalty and advocacy?
A company can ensure that its customer-centric initiatives are driving long-term customer loyalty and advocacy by consistently seeking feedback from customers to understand their needs and preferences. Additionally, implementing personalized experiences, rewards programs, and excellent customer service can help build strong relationships with customers. It is also important to measure and track customer satisfaction and loyalty metrics to evaluate the success of these initiatives and make adjustments as needed to continue improving the customer experience. Finally, fostering a customer-centric culture within the organization, where all employees are aligned around the goal of putting the customer first, can help ensure that customer loyalty and advocacy are prioritized in all aspects of the business.
